'The way to deal with this is to provide for the best education possible in every single school' - Fmr. VP Joe Biden, speaking at Public Education Forum 2020, on how he'd address increasingly segregated schools

Asked about how to deal with segregated schools at the Public Education Forum 2020, former Vice President and presidential candidate Joe Biden said, "The way to deal with this is to provide for the best education possible in every single school.
